an entire set of 23 human chromosomes is called a genome the human genome is composed of 3 billion base pairs variation at a single base pair is called a snip or single nucleotide polymorphism when the body makes new cells it doesnt make many mistakes but nobodys perfect sometimes when the genome is copied to make a new cell a single base pair gets left out added or substituted single base pair substitutions create slips there are around 10 million snips in the human genome which account for many of the genetic differences between you and everyone else on the planet some snips account for differences in appearance others can affect how we develop diseases or respond to drugs most snips however seem to lead to no observable differences between people at all since variants are passed on from one generation to the next the number of differences between your DNA and your neighbors can tell you how closely you are related to each other

An example of an SNP is the substitution of a C for a G in the nucleotide sequence AACGAT, thereby producing the sequence AACCAT. The DNA of humans may contain many SNPs, since these variations occur at a rate of one in every 100300 nucleotides in the human genome.
If SNPs change either the function of a gene or its expression, and the change provides greater fitness for a population (i.e., a higher capacity to survive and/or reproduce in a given environment), the change will be favored by natural selection. Therefore, SNPs can be the basis of evolutionary change.
By targeting SNPs contained in both coding and non-coding areas of the genome, we are able to identify genetic differences and characterize genome-wide patterns of variation among individuals, populations and species.
Whole genome sequencing has been widely used in SNP identification and analysis. Typically, hundreds of thousands of SNPs are identified through genome-wide comparison between a targeted genotype and the reference genome. These SNPs might be useful in developing large-scale, genotyping-based breeding selection tools.
A DNA sequence variation that occurs when a single nucleotide (adenine, thymine, cytosine, or guanine) in the genome sequence is altered and the particular alteration is present in at least 1% of the population. Also called single nucleotide polymorphism.
Most commonly, SNPs are found in the DNA between genes. They can act as biological markers, helping scientists locate genes that are associated with disease. When SNPs occur within a gene or in a regulatory region near a gene, they may play a more direct role in disease by affecting the genes function.
